3. Description:
Take the expense and the mystery out of large-scale reverse osmosis plants with a Containerized system. By making pre-designed, module-sized plants, fully assembled in standard 20-ft and 40-ft containers with the option for a 10-ft as well, the complexity and the construction of a building to house a water purification plant is no longer necessary. The container just needs to be shipped out to where the potable water is needed, and after a brief training session, commissioned workers are ready to produce high-quality potable water within days of delivery.

Temperature ("Hot/Cold" Containers)
In hot climate areas - electrical devices and fluids must be kept below 35 ℃ to ensure good process performance. The temperature inside a container placed under direct sunlight can easily reach 80 ℃, therefore we offer air-cooled insulated containers with an external sunlight rejection coating.
In cold climate area - fluids must be kept above their freezing points and electrical equipment suffers at temperatures below 5 ℃. In this case, we offer insulated containers with heating equipment.
